The instructor will teach an aPHR course covering various HR topics. This course prepares students for the HR Certification Institute aPHR certification exam.
Candidates must have a minimum of 3-5 years of teaching experience and at least 3 years in a related field. An active aPHR certification is also required.
ProTrain is currently recruiting an experienced instructor with experience teaching an APHR course. Candidates must have experience teaching in a classroom or/and in a synchronous environment, as well as have a minimum of 3 years as an APHR
This is a part time, contracted teaching position to begin immediately. Future classes will be available to the right candidate.
